您当前的位置:首页 > 常见问答

数据库生长因子的作用和应用分析

作者:远客网络

数据库生长因子是指影响数据库大小和容量增长的各种因素。它们可以是技术因素、业务因素或者是其他外部因素。下面是数据库生长因子的五个主要方面:

  1. 数据量增长:数据库生长的一个主要因素是数据量的增加。随着业务的发展和数据的积累,数据库中存储的数据量会不断增加。这可能是由于新的业务需求、用户数量增加、数据采集或者其他因素导致的。数据量的增长将直接影响数据库的大小和容量。

  2. 数据模型和结构变化:数据库的数据模型和结构的变化也会导致数据库生长。当业务需求发生变化或者新的功能需要添加到数据库中时,可能需要对数据库的结构进行调整和优化。这可能包括添加新的表、字段或者索引,或者对现有的结构进行修改。这些变化会导致数据库的大小和容量增加。

  3. 数据库设计和优化:数据库设计和优化的不合理或者不完善也会导致数据库的生长。如果数据库的设计不够合理,可能会导致数据冗余、重复存储或者性能问题,从而增加数据库的大小和容量。因此,合理的数据库设计和优化是控制数据库生长的重要因素。

  4. 存储技术和硬件资源:数据库的存储技术和硬件资源也会影响数据库的生长。不同的存储技术和硬件资源对数据库的容量和性能有不同的影响。例如,使用高效的压缩算法可以减少数据库的存储空间,而使用高性能的硬件资源可以提高数据库的处理能力。因此,选择合适的存储技术和硬件资源是控制数据库生长的重要因素。

  5. 数据备份和恢复策略:数据库备份和恢复策略也会影响数据库的生长。如果备份和恢复策略不合理或者不完善,可能会导致数据冗余、重复存储或者备份文件过多,从而增加数据库的大小和容量。因此,合理的备份和恢复策略是控制数据库生长的重要因素。

数据库生长因子是指影响数据库大小和容量增长的各种因素,包括数据量增长、数据模型和结构变化、数据库设计和优化、存储技术和硬件资源以及数据备份和恢复策略。合理地管理和控制这些因素将有助于有效地管理数据库的生长。

数据库生长因子是指影响数据库大小增长的各种因素。数据库的大小通常取决于数据量的增加和存储结构的变化。以下是一些常见的数据库生长因子:

  1. 数据量增长:数据库中存储的数据量增加是导致数据库大小增长的主要因素。随着业务的发展和数据的积累,数据库中的数据量会不断增加,从而导致数据库的大小增长。

  2. 数据结构变化:数据库中的数据结构变化也是导致数据库大小增长的因素之一。当对数据库进行更新、插入或删除操作时,数据库中的数据结构可能会发生变化,例如添加新的表、增加字段、删除表等,这些变化可能会导致数据库的大小增加。

  3. 索引的增加:索引是用于提高数据库查询效率的重要组成部分。当在数据库中创建索引时,会占用一定的存储空间。随着索引的增加,数据库的大小也会相应增加。

  4. 日志文件的增长:数据库的日志文件用于记录数据库中的操作和变化,以便在发生故障时进行恢复。随着数据库操作的增加,日志文件的大小也会增加,从而导致数据库的大小增长。

  5. 临时表和缓存数据:在数据库操作过程中,临时表和缓存数据的使用也可能导致数据库的大小增加。临时表和缓存数据通常存储在内存中,但在某些情况下可能会被写入磁盘,从而占用数据库的存储空间。

数据库生长因子是多种因素综合作用的结果。数据量增长、数据结构变化、索引的增加、日志文件的增长以及临时表和缓存数据的使用都可能导致数据库的大小增加。为了有效管理数据库的大小,需要合理规划数据库的存储空间,并定期进行数据库维护和优化。

数据库生长因子(Database Growth Factor)是指数据库在一段时间内增长的比例或速度。它用于衡量数据库的增长情况,以便进行容量规划和资源管理。

数据库生长因子可以根据不同的指标进行衡量,如数据量、表数量、索引数量等。下面是一些常用的指标和方法来计算数据库生长因子:

  1. 数据量:数据库的数据量是衡量数据库生长的重要指标之一。可以通过监控数据库的存储空间占用情况来获取数据量的增长趋势。通常使用的指标有总数据量、每日新增数据量等。

  2. 表数量:数据库中的表数量也是一个重要的生长指标。可以通过查询系统表来获取当前数据库中的表数量,并比较不同时期的表数量来计算生长因子。

  3. 索引数量:索引对数据库性能有重要影响,因此索引数量也是一个需要关注的生长指标。可以通过查询系统表来获取当前数据库中的索引数量,并比较不同时期的索引数量来计算生长因子。

计算数据库生长因子的方法有多种,下面是一种常用的方法:

  1. 选择一个时间段:可以选择一个较长的时间段(如一个月或一年)来计算数据库的生长因子。

  2. 计算起始值:在所选时间段的起始点,记录数据库的指标值(如数据量、表数量、索引数量)作为起始值。

  3. 计算结束值:在所选时间段的结束点,记录数据库的指标值作为结束值。

  4. 计算增长量:计算起始值和结束值之间的增长量,即结束值减去起始值。

  5. 计算生长因子:将增长量除以起始值,再乘以100,即可得到数据库的生长因子。

例如,假设在一个月的时间段内,数据库的数据量从100GB增长到150GB,那么增长量为150GB – 100GB = 50GB,起始值为100GB,生长因子为(50GB / 100GB)* 100 = 50%。

通过计算数据库的生长因子,可以帮助管理员了解数据库的增长趋势,及时进行容量规划和资源管理,以确保数据库的正常运行和高效性能。